I have a workbook what had a formula in column E . What Im trying to do is when there is a data change in column E I need the data changed to values so it knocks out the formula on the cell where the data changed.
SUM is used to ADD (Sum) up the values of a multi-cell range (I am not sure why, but for some inexplicable reason, many people seem to want to use the SUM formula in every mathematical computation).
